Rumble in the Jungle 8A (+) by Tina Hafsaas

Tina Hafsaas, #4 in Chamonix Lead WC in 2017, has done two 8A's and Rumble in the Jungle 8A (+) in Hueco Tanks. More pics and info on her Insta, (c) Thilo Schröter. "I’m having a blast here in Hueco Tanks. The style suits me pretty well with steep and long climbing mainly on crimps. I had a great week by sending Le Chninkel and Sunshine each in one session and finish Rumble in the Jungle pretty fast as well. Now I’m sucked into project mode on a few boulders that feel harder for me. They challenge me in styles and techniques I’m not as good at and I hope I will finish them off before we head to Red Rocks. I will do the full lead World Cup and the European and World Championship in lead. I will not aim for the Olympics as the format does not feel like the sport I am passionate about."
